Thatching is the process of eliminating the layer of dead grass, roots, and natural debris that accumulates between the soil and living grass, which can hinder water, air, and nutrient absorption. Extreme thatch can cause shallow root systems, increased insect problems, and unequal growth. Methods for thatching include handbook raking or the use of specialized dethatching equipment that lifts and gets rid of the layer without harmful healthy grass The process is typically followed by aeration, overseeding, or fertilization to promote healthy healing and growth. Regular thatching guarantees better soil-to-grass contact, improves nutrient uptake, and keeps a lush, durable yard. Integrating thatching into yard care regimens improves both the look and long-term health of turf.
